Muhammad Khairul Akmal Bin Rokisham (born 28 May 1998) is a Malaysian professional football player who plays as a defender for Penang in the Malaysia Super League. [1]
On 7 May 2017, Akmal made his first-team debut for Penang coming on as a substitute for Zulkhairi Zulkeply in the 83rd minute of 1–2 loss match against Felda United at Penang State. [2]
